What are uPVC Doors?
uPVC is a high-performance material extensively utilized in the building of doors and windows. Unlike standard PVC, uPVC is stiff and does not sag, making it particularly suitable for frames, specifically in doors with large glass panels. The mix of uPVC and windows provides a versatile option that satisfies the demands of contemporary visual appeals and performance.
Key Features of uPVC Doors with Windows
Here are the primary characteristics that make uPVC doors with windows a favored option:

Durability and Longevity: uPVC doors are resistant to rot, rust, and corrosion, ensuring a long lifespan with minimal upkeep.

Energy Efficiency: Their style supplies better insulation, which helps in maintaining indoor temperatures, reducing heating & cooling costs.

Low Maintenance: Unlike wood or metal frames, uPVC needs only occasional cleansing to look brand name new. It is not subject to peeling, flaking, or fading.

Visual Variety: uPVC doors come in various designs and colors, allowing homeowners to develop customized looks that match their home's exterior and interior.

Security Features: Most modern uPVC doors include multi-point locking systems that boost home security.

There are several designs of uPVC doors offered that integrate windows. Each design serves various aesthetic and practical needs:

French Doors: Typically opening outward and featuring glass panes throughout the door, French doors produce a sophisticated and open feel, suitable for patio areas or garden gain access to.

Bi-Folding Doors: These doors include numerous panels that fold to the side, making the most of space and effortlessly mixing indoor and outdoor areas.

Sliding Doors: Sliding uPVC doors are exceptional for compact areas, providing a smooth shift between the interior and exterior without sacrificing style.

Stable Doors: Often defined by a split design, stable doors enable customizable access, making them ideal for cooking areas or energy areas.

FAQs about uPVC Doors with Windows1. The length of time do uPVC doors last?
uPVC doors can last anywhere from 20 to 35 years, depending on upkeep and direct exposure to the aspects.
2. Are uPVC doors energy-efficient?
Yes, uPVC doors offer excellent insulation, adding to energy effectiveness by lowering heat loss or gain.
3. Can I paint uPVC doors?
While it's possible to paint uPVC doors, it's generally not suggested as they need specific paint types. It is much better to pick a color that fits your aesthetic needs from the start.
4. How do I clean uPVC doors and windows?
You can clean up uPVC doors and windows with soapy water and a soft fabric. Avoid abrasive cleaners that may scratch the surface.
5. Are uPVC doors environmentally friendly?
uPVC is a recyclable product, making it a more sustainable option than some other materials when disposed of effectively.
